If there's a block that is built facing a certain direction, like stripped logs for example, you are also able to do that using WorldEdit. To have it facing a certain way, you'd use // (command) (block) [ axis=y/x/z]. By using this mod you will gain access to more than 20 different commands and a selection tool which you can use to both edit the world around you as well as add new things to it.Brushes. Brush tools are a more specific set of tools. They're meant to sculpt, shape and paint the world. You can bind a brush to almost any vanilla item, as long as you are holding it. For example, ;brush sphere log 5 Binds a sphere brush to the item you're holding. Now, you need to select a block from the ground and left ...Generation commands are commands which create unique shapes from the point where you are standing. You can use them to make round towers, balls, and perfect circles (etc). Brush commands are commands used for building, drawing, painting and shaping from far away, usually on terrain or organics. But the command //wand doesn't work and when I get a wooden axe from the creative inventory … Press J to jump to the feed.2. Press the "/" or "t" button on your keyboard to open up the chat option. In the chat textbox, type the command in the following format: //sphere block_name number_of_blocks and press Enter. That means, if you want to create an iron ore sphere with 11 blocks from the center, the command will be //sphere iron_ore 11.WorldEdit User's Manual.
